ABSTRACT

This article concentrates on the national services and databases in the Nordic countries. The availability of information via networks is the main discussion topic. The Nordic libraries have a long tradition of cooperation. The basic idea at present is to make the national information of each country available to all users within Scandinavia, to create a “Union Nordic Library.” The necessary qualifications for that kind of co-operation are very good: the development of the national systems is in process or already operational at a high technical level; the Nordic research networks are connected to each other and to international networks; the data itself is in standardized form and very well covers the recent publications.
